I play super casually and something I love are the incidental narratives that come from decks.

As an example, my gf has a powerful Quetzal deck that generates a lot of value from [[Quality Time]], [[Liberated Account]], [[Katie Jones]], and [[Bloo Moose]].

So essentially, Quetzal goes on a relaxing vacation with their BFF while absolutely decimating the poor corporation.
